FC Cincinnati 2 return to Scudamore Field at NKU Soccer Stadium on Sunday, August 30 when the Orange and Blue host Philadelphia Union II at noon in the penultimate home match of the season. FC Cincinnati 2 is coming off a 3-1 road win against Carolina Core FC and will look to close the year out strong over the final four matches.

FC Cincinnati 2/Matchup Notes
The matchup – Sunday’s match marks the third and final meeting of the season between FC Cincinnati 2 and Philadelphia Union II. The two sides will meet at NKU Soccer Stadium for the first time since August 31, 2025, when Union II took three points in a 2-1 win. The all-time series has been a competitive one with nine of the 12 games being decided by just one goal and no match ending in a draw.
Cheikhou Niang scored in the previous meeting against Philadelphia, brining the match level in the 40th minute, with his fifth goal of the season. Niang trails Stefan Chirila (10) for goals scored but has been just as efficient in his minutes played. Niang is finding the back of the net once every 166 minutes (169 for Chirila).
Chirila scored the match winner against Carolina Core FC from the penalty spot to go along with goals from Sami Lachekar and Nathan Gray. Lachekar’s opening goal is his first for the Orange and Blue while Gray’s second of the season came in a substitute appearance.
FC Cincinnati Academy goalkeeper David Paz made his second consecutive start in goal for the Orange and Blue and finished the match with four saves.
Scouting Philadelphia Union 2
Record: 9-11-4 (33 points)
Standings: 12th Eastern Conference
Last Three: 4-2 loss vs. CT United FC | 4-3 win at New England Revolution II | 2-1 win vs FC Cincinnati 2
Head Coach: Chris Harmon (Interim)
Leading Scorer: 10 – Stas Korzeniowski
Philadelphia Union II enter Sunday’s match needing three points to stay alive in the playoff hunt. While a loss against the Orange and Blue wouldn’t mathematically eliminate Philadelphia from making it into the playoffs, it would all but end their chances at advancing to the postseason. Union II visit Cincy on the back of a 4-2 loss against CT United FC.
Forward Stas Korzeniowski will play a big role in keeping Union II in with a chance, as the forward leads the team in goals scored with 10. Korzeniowski is responsible for 10 of the club’s 30 goals this season and added two to his stat sheet against CT United.
A combined 13 goals have been scored in Union II’s last two matches with Philadelphia scoring six but conceding seven. Things have opened up for the Union II attack as of late where the team has scored two or more goals in three straight. Prior to their current run of attacking form, Philadelphia had scored multiple goals just five times this season.
